Handover note — Crumbwheel order cutoffs.

Welcome aboard. The bakery cutoff rule in Crumbwheel closes same-day orders at 14:00 local to each storefront, not UTC — this has bitten us twice. Holiday overrides live in the calendar service and take precedence silently, so always check there first when a cutoff looks wrong. To unlock the calendar service's admin console after a restart, enter the recovery passphrase below.

vault phrase of bagap-bahaf = silion-pelox-sorox-casdor-quenwyn-fraax-eliox-praael-kelion-quenvan-kasox-rusael-norius-belvan

So you're writing a plugin against the Mapmoss tile cache — good call checking provenance first. Every cache layer build is stamped at bake time, and mismatched stamps are the number one cause of "my tiles look stale" reports. Before you blame your plugin, compare your runtime's stamp against the published one. The stamps are short tokens, easy to eyeball. The current verified cache-layer build token is listed right below this paragraph.

session token of tajef-bageg = htk21_5d90d574934f3ccae6437

### Why did my redo history disappear after a branch edit?

Sketchloom keeps a linear undo stack per canvas. When you undo several steps and then make a new edit, the orphaned redo entries are intentionally discarded rather than forked, because merging divergent histories caused corrupted node references in earlier builds. Do not "fix" this without reading the history-model design note. Questions about edge cases should go to the editor-core maintainers.

escalation mailbox, bafog-fafog: ulador@paliqlabs.internal